A female student of Chinese descent from Melbourne was fined over $10,000 for breaking orders

Source: xkb.com.au
 08 Apr 2020

Police in Melbourne last night said seven women had dinner in Nanan District (Southbank) in violation of the ban. Police arrived at the scene, each issued a $$1652 ticket, a total fine of $$11564.

The seven women studied in Melbourne, China citizen, were fined 1652 for violating social estrangement laws $the new crown.

A notice of infringement obtained by the Herald Sun confirmed that around 9 p.m. seven parties were fined.

A ticket issued by the police. Source: Pioneer Sun)


It is understood that four women live together in this apartment and the other three are guests.

It is reported that the State Police has issued 114 fines in the past 24 hours, of which 7 are of this type.

Other groups fined included three people playing video games in the lounge because they did not live together, and four others were punished for looking for drug in the street.
